Bubbling potions can be bad for your health! Just ask Dr. Jekyll. By day, he's a kind doctor. But by night, he's the merciless kill Mr. Hyde. And all because of a magic formula. Will anybody find out the horrible secret of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de?

"This book was very different from what I expected. I only had a vague impression of the story: Dr. Jekyll is transformed into the evil-doing Mr. Hyde by some strange concoction of potions. The rest of what I knew came from the musical. Now, I know that there are usually liberties taken when a book is transformed into a musical...but I had no idea just how many were taken here! <br/><br/>That being said, I quite enjoyed experiencing this classic in its original form. No additions or adaptations. I feel it would have been more mysterious and perhaps even shocking if I had read it in 1886, before it became such a commonplace theme in our world."
